At present, I am studying in a university in the UK with a four-year visa. Now I want to travel to other European countries. What should I do with it?

First, you need to decide the route. Round-trip air tickets and confirmation letters of all hotel accommodations are necessary. These funds are prepared at a cost of 55 pounds a day. Then, you need a study certificate issued by the school and a bank statement, preferably the original bank statement. However, due to the requirement of printing within one month from the delivery date, if the online bank statement is printed, the bank needs to stamp and sign on each page. According to experience, Lloyd TSB provides better service, so don't be NATWEST.

The French visa I applied for before was handed in in mid-July, which is also the peak of summer vacation. I signed it the next working day after submission. French visas are fast, but the number of days given is quite small. For the first time, your trip usually takes a few days.
